## Releases

Gridhand admin-table releases go out weekly. The bulk-edit module is versioned with the core table; never ship them separately. Run the mass-update smoke test before tagging. All release bundles are signed in CI. To verify a bundle locally, import the current signing key, which follows below.

signing key of fahof-tahof = bky13_rpcUNgEnLB4i2

## Add `tailtap follow --since` and retry backoff

This PR extends our internal log-tailing CLI (tailtap, owned by the Ravelin platform team) with a `--since` flag and exponential backoff when the aggregator drops the stream. For context, since you're new: tailtap speaks to the Corvass log gateway over long-polling, and previously a dropped connection meant restarting from the live head, losing lines. Now we checkpoint the last offset and resume. Backoff and buffer behavior are governed by module constants, reproduced here for review.

constants for bawif-kawif:
QUOTAS = {
    "ulaael": 5,
    "holael": 10,
}

Ticket: FormulaBox vault locked again

Heads up, new folks — the sandbox that runs user-supplied formulas pulls its signing cert from the Tidlow vault, and the vault sealed itself after last night's restart. Until auto-unseal lands, we do it by hand. The recovery passphrase you'll need is right below.

vault phrase of bagaf-kajeg = jorath-feniel-briir-siliel-ralix